Check In
Check Out
Hotels in Cyprus
200+ HOTELS IN CYPRUS
Infinity Pool Indoor Pool Panoramic View Pool Pool Swim Up Bar Private Pool Outdoor Pool
Heated Pool Indoor Pool Pool Swim Up Bar Outdoor Pool
Heated Pool Indoor Pool Pool Swim Up Bar Outdoor Pool
Pool Water Slide Outdoor Pool
Pool Water Slide Outdoor Pool
Heated Pool Indoor Pool Children's Pool Outdoor Pool
Heated Pool Indoor Pool Children's Pool Outdoor Pool